Output baf958486a7c6086ad51b21b44d55ba9b77c42fafad6907da248b97570694377:27
- value
- 38513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e539a2148622334eedddf46818f8a91e7ba9933e OP_EQUAL
- address
- 3Nb3htjGuqZvujrwDkGFzX5i6hAc5dxPyf
- transaction
- baf958486a7c6086ad51b21b44d55ba9b77c42fafad6907da248b97570694377
- spent
- true